Former Messalonskee High School standout Nick Mayo led his Eastern Kentucky team with 15 points but the Colonels were no match for #11 Louisville. The Cardinals beat EKU 87-56 Saturday afternoon.

The 6-foot-9 Mayo filled the Colonels stat sheet with those 15 points, plus four rebounds, four assists and a block against Rick Pitino's team.

The loss drops EKU to 6-6.

Mayo, a sophomore, was the Ohio Valley Conference Rookie of the Year last year and his 18.9 PPG this year leads the team.

11th ranked Louisville is now 10-1.

EKU and Louisville have played 74 times over the years but Saturday's game was the first since 2004.
